As a Senior Solicitor, you'll have a role that's out of the ordinary. You will play a key role in enabling the business to deliver some of the UK's most important clean energy, defence, and international programmes. Client Details FTSE listed business in the Engineering space Description Lead the drafting, review, and negotiation of complex commercial agreements, including Joint Ventures, Teaming Agreements, MOUs, and high-value supply chain contracts. Provide clear, practical legal advice to commercial colleagues supporting UK and international projects. Partner with project, engineering, and commercial teams to ensure contract compliance and manage legal risk. Advise on specialist topics, including nuclear liability, regulated environments, and long-term contracting models. Support the Commercial Director with strategic atters and contribute to business-wide continuous improvement Profile Qualified Solicitor admitted to the roll in England & Wales (or equivalent UK jurisdiction)…
